2017-09-21 58 views
0

我創建一個數據庫腳本,並在執行它具有錯誤分配空間。我正在嘗試創建一個數據庫並分配空間。我要去哪裏錯了錯誤而到數據庫

以下是錯誤消息

MODIFY FILE遇到操作系統錯誤112(檢索不到該錯誤文本原因:15105),同時試圖擴大物理文件「E:\ MSSQL10_50 .SQL2008R2 \ MSSQL \ DATA \ CoreReferenceStaging.mdf」。

USE master 
    GO 

    CREATE DATABASE CoreReferenceStaging; 
    GO 

    ALTER DATABASE [CoreReferenceStaging] 
    MODIFY FILE (NAME = N'CoreReferenceStaging', SIZE = 51200000KB , FILEGROWTH = 2560000KB) 
    GO 

    ALTER DATABASE [CoreReferenceStaging] 
    MODIFY FILE (NAME = N'CoreReferenceStaging_log', SIZE = 15360000KB , FILEGROWTH = 1024000KB) 
    GO 
+0

當我從命令提示輸入'NET HELPMSG 112',將所得的消息是「沒有在磁盤上足夠的空間」。 –

回答

2

從命令提示符處輸入NET HELPMSG 112,最終的消息是「磁盤空間不足」。這似乎不存在E盤捲上有足夠的空間來將文件擴展到指定的大小。

0

你FILEGROWTH是太大了(2.5GB)。它可能不會增長那麼多。將其更改爲100MB(100000KB)。你的日誌也一樣。